Bergen, Partners Launch $12 Million Healthcare Grant
2019年9月25日 · The four-year NJ HealthWorks initiative includes 14 community colleges and healthcare partners such as CVS Health, the Health Care Association of New Jersey and the RWJBarnabas Health System. The New Jersey Department of Labor and Workforce Development also supported the consortium’s application.

Admissions - Bergen Community College
NJ STARS: The New Jersey Student Tuition Assistance Reward Scholarship (NJ STARS) Program is an initiative created by the State of New Jersey that provides New Jersey’s highest achieving students with free tuition at their home county college for 12-18 college-level credits in the fall and spring semesters for up to five semesters.

Veterans in New Jersey - USAFacts
2023年10月27日 · In 2022, 279,664.0 veterans lived in New Jersey. 3.90% of the adult civilian population in New Jersey were considered veterans. Learn more about the veteran population of New Jersey. What era did they serve in? How do their characteristics differ from non-veterans.
How many people die from gun-related injuries in New Jersey
2024年12月9日 · In 2023, the highest rate of gun-related deaths in New Jersey occurred in Cumberland County, NJ (13.9 per 100,000 people). The lowest rate was in Middlesex County, NJ (2.7 per 100,000).
